(Web Desk): The newly elected mayor of the German town of Herdecke has been seriously injured in a knife attack.
57-year-old Iris Stalter was attacked on Tuesday, according to German broadcaster WDR, which reported that she was stabbed multiple times outside her home. Despite her injuries, she managed to drag herself inside the house.
In a joint statement, prosecutors and police said that investigations are ongoing from all angles, and the involvement of a close relative cannot be ruled out.
According to the DPA news agency, Stalter’s 15-year-old son and 17-year-old daughter have been taken into custody for questioning. Authorities said that Stalter was airlifted to a hospital, where she remains in intensive care.
The newspaper Bild, citing investigators, reported that Stalter’s son told police that multiple individuals attacked his mother.
The incident occurred shortly after local elections in North Rhine-Westphalia, which politicians described as being marked by increased tension and hostility.
Iris Stalter, a member of the Social Democratic Party (SPD), was scheduled to officially take office in November following her election victory.
